JAKARTA - As a short-term goal, Indonesia Football Assosiation (PSSI) back targeting talented young players to become naturalized.
Secretary General PSSI, Ade Wellington mentions continue to monitor the progress of the blooded Indonesia players which is now a career abroad. This was done because the national soccer parent wants naturalized the number of footballers.
Ade explained one of the players who want to become naturalized bloody Indonesia is the Juventus goalkeeper, Emil Audero Mulyadi. The 20-year-old player have Indonesian blood from his father Edi Mulyadi which also was born at Acacia Mataram maternity hospital, Indonesia.
Besides Audero, former Lazio player which now joint Italian Serie D, Trastevere, Lorenzo Pace also become target naturalized.
"They are all still in the monitoring process. From the Netherlands there are two, one who played in Belgium his age was 20 years. In Italy there Mulyadi and Pace. The remaining seven people in Spain who practice in Valencia," said Ade.
He added, there are about 13 players who get into it for naturalized watchlist. The footballer is spread across several areas of Europe and Asia.
Previously, Ezra Walian will certainly be the first naturalized player. This Jong Ajax striker is expected to defend Indonesia U-23 national team that will compete in the SEA Games in 2017, Kuala Lumpur, Malaysia.
